    Hi! sorry im late to the party but i've been heavily considering these silvers neomax (with swifts) over FA500's since i have a tight budget and i do like to go on track once or twice a year. Do you think it's worth giving silvers a shot over FA500's? i'm sure FA500's is alot better but is the performance of silvers enough to get close to FA's while maintaining that good price tag

    • @circuitdemon_
      @circuitdemon_  5 місяців тому +1

      Personally I don’t think I would get them again. They were okay but did have some sounds to them. I would bucket them with other coils in the same price range.
      Fortune’s are really great, more customizable, and if you do plan on performance driving the car rebuildable.
      Rebuildable is important for 2 reasons; down the road you can have them totally refreshed for a fraction of new coils and they can be upgraded to the 510 model. I actually had my 500’s rebuilt to 510’s a few years ago. At the time I didn’t need the 510’s and the price difference put them out of my range. As I got into tracking the car and putting some wear on them it was a huge benefit to do a simple upgrade.
